Democratic Party of Serbia (Democratic Party of Serbia (Demoanka Strije ão DSS) Chairman Milos Jovanovic has declared that Kosovo's surrender would soon open the issue of the Raska (Sanzak) region, southern Serbia (The Valley of Presevo) and Vojvodina.
He, as the portal “danas” conveys, in the tributaries of this party in Kraleva has said this means that in the future generations will deal with geopolitical rather than dealing with Serbia's economy and development.
“Situten must be kept in the state of the frozen conflict, which means there are currently no final solution“, Jovanovic has said.
The DSS leader has stressed that the act is “the open conflict”.
When Vuciqi says that “is fighting for restriction”, that means accepting the session and independence of 90-95 percent of Kosovo's territory”, has praised Jovanovic.
Someone in 1999 could tell soldiers and police in Kosovo that they are wasting their lives because some are planning Kosovo's surrender. What Vuchqi intends to do, no one has ever had in mind in these last six centuries”, he said.
Stateist Movement Chairman Slobodan Samardzic has said that Serbia's power has moral, political and constitutional obligation to protect Kosovo.
Kosovo is currently occupied territory. And if you give up that territory, internationally, the owner with whom the deal has been made, Samardzic said, transmits Koha.net.
It has estimated that power could turn around in Kosovo's ongoing policy, but it is not.
According to the other DSS official,Milosh Kovic, Serbia is now on the verge of the greatest betrayal in history.
“Biological nationalism, pure ethnic territories are the ideas of Republika and its Foreign Affairs Minister“, Kovic has said.
He has estimated that the same scenario for Macedonia and Montenegro is being prepared for Serbia from the West.
Kovic has said it is good that protests are being held in Serbia, “because power is fluctuating”, but it is not good that Kosovo's topic is not being mentioned in the protests.
